When applying the Realtek ALC888 legacy driver, my sounds does work, but upon boot - my USB Keyboard and mouse do not work for anywhere between 2 to 4 minutes....
Until I get the Keyboard and Mouse functionality, I see the following kernel message in the event log:
- kernel: IOHIDSystem: postEvent LLEventQueue overflow.
and
- hidd: Timeout waiting for IOKit to be quiet
Once finally I get these two errors, keyboard and mouse start working:
- WindowServer: Unable to open IOHIDSystem (e00002bd)
- virtual bool IOHIDEventSystemUserClient::initWithTask(task_t, void *, UIInt32): Client task not privileged to open IOHIDSystem for mapping memory (e00002c1)
Any help would be greatly appreciated. This starts happening just after I install the MultiBeast 5.2.1 -> Drivers -> Audio -> Realtek ALC8xx -> Witout DSDT -> ALC888 -> v100202 Legacy driver.
It replaces my AppleHDA.kext and adds HDAEnabler1.kext - and sounds start working, but keyboard and mouse do not respond for up to 4 minutes.
I got ML 10.8.2 installed. Thanks.
